Liked Spacious pitch, flushing toilets, good location, lots of quirky parts to keep kids busy; hammock swings, tree house and little walk through bushes.
Disliked No bins, you have to take rubbish with you and we know it’s to help global footprint but the reality is everyone will have rubbish and when you pack up after a weekend the last thing you want is bags of rubbish to take home! It’s not helping global footprint it’s just putting rubbish elsewhere and saving them money on bin disposal.
We didn’t get an email confirmation or any communication from owners, we only met them when our friends called to ask for wood on the last day out of 3. (Not really a dislike just to say it’s very much an unsupervised site).
